二叉樹葉子結(jié)點總數(shù)的算法 完全二叉樹的葉子節(jié)點數(shù)公式?
完全二叉樹的葉子節(jié)點數(shù)公式?讓節(jié)點數(shù)為n(總是奇數(shù)),葉節(jié)點數(shù)為m,那么m=(n1)/2n=m*2-1一個完整的二叉樹有好幾層。例如,一個三層完全二叉樹有7個節(jié)點,節(jié)點總數(shù)為(2的3倍)減1,葉節(jié)點數(shù)
完全二叉樹的葉子節(jié)點數(shù)公式?
讓節(jié)點數(shù)為n(總是奇數(shù)),葉節(jié)點數(shù)為m,那么
m=(n1)/2
n=m*2-1
一個完整的二叉樹有好幾層。例如,一個三層完全二叉樹有7個節(jié)點,節(jié)點總數(shù)為(2的3倍)減1,葉節(jié)點數(shù)為(1的3倍)減2,即4。
如果是n級完全二叉樹,則節(jié)點總數(shù)為(2的n次方)減1;葉節(jié)點數(shù)為2(1的n次方);這將非常簡單。這次你明白了嗎?
一棵完全二叉樹共有個節(jié)點,該二叉樹有多少葉子節(jié)點?怎么算,謝謝?
葉節(jié)點數(shù)為(699 1)/2=350。